The age of consent in NSW treats young gay men like criminals As a result young gay men can suffer low self-esteem and are unfairly limited in their access to important health and welfare services. The law is different for young gay men as the age of consent is two years higher than the legal age for all other people and there are much harsher penalties than for everyone else. There is no reason for continuing to treat young gay men differently. The University of New South Wales has proven in recent research that not only is there no evidence anywhere in the world to support a discriminatory age of consent but that the unequal age of consent is actually harmful to young gay men. The Government is unable to provide any evidence or any justification to support these discriminatory laws and whilst the government and parliament plays politics and treats young gay men as criminals, young gay men continue to have limited access to health and welfare services at a time when they need it the most. NSW is now the LAST STATE for equal and non-discriminatory age of consent laws. The Gay and Lesbian Rights Lobby (GLRL) fights discrimination every day but we need your help!
